Blackstone Fried Rice

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 cups cold, cooked white rice (preferably day-old)
  • 1 tbsp vegetable oil
  • 1 tbsp sesame oil
  • 2 eggs, beaten
  • 1 cup frozen peas and carrots, thawed
  • 2 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ste
  • 2 green onions, sliced (optional, for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Preheat griddle: Heat Blackstone griddle to medium-high and brush surface with vegetable oil.
  2. Cook eggs: Scramble beaten eggs on one side of griddle, then push aside once cooked.
  3. Sauté veggies: Add sesame oil and sauté peas and carrots until heated through.
  4. Add rice: Spread cold rice on the griddle, breaking up clumps. Let it sear for 1–2 minutes for a golden crust.
  5. Season: Add soy sauce,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Stir to combine.
  6. Combine: Fold eggs back in and toss everything together evenly.
  7. Serve: Garnish with sliced green onions and enjoy hot.

Notes

  • Always use cold, day-old rice for the best texture.
  • Don’t overcrowd the griddle — it helps rice crisp instead of steam.
  • Adjust soy sauce to taste; use low-sodium for a lighter option.
  • Add proteins like shrimp, chicken, or tofu for a heartier version.
  • Top with a fried egg or sesame seeds for presentation.
